UPVC windows slow down the spread of fire

It is essential to take into consideration the safety of your home when installing doors or windows in your home. uPVC is the best material for fire protection. It is a high-chlorine content material, which is a flame-repellent. However, it also comes with the added benefit of being resistant to mould and pollution.

As with other plastics has been established that it's not as easily ignited as it might first appear. It is the reason it is the one that has been chosen for use in a variety of rigid applicationslike window frames and doors.

uPVC is also resistant to water and moisture and is easy to clean. This makes it a preferred choice among property owners. UPVC is available in a wide range of colours and styles, allowing you to select a product that is suitable for your home.

Despite its strength, uPVC is not as robust as aluminium and may fail in a fire accident. Moreover, if a window is damaged or weak it could contribute to the spread of fire and smoke into the apartment. This is why fire rating requirements are typically needed for many buildings.

The most important benefit of uPVC is its resistance to ignition. The chlorine contained in uPVC helps to ensure it remains non-flammable. Once the source of the ignition is removed then the uPVC frame ceases to burn which stops the window from creating the fire.

UPVC windows can be produced in mass quantities

UPVC windows are made in factory settings. Based on the preference of the manufacturer the variety of styles and designs are available. Most of the time, they are airtight, and super robust. They are able to endure rain and Sash windows Upvc wind and are also colourfast and termite resistant.

The first step in the production of uPVC windows is to produce a uPVC resin. This resin is mixed with additives and various chemicals to improve its performance and durability. It is also tested for quality.

After the resin is formed, it is then heated to a high temperature. The molten resin is pushed through a mould. When it is released it's formed into long sections of a frame. It becomes more manageable to work with as the profile cools.

Once the profiles have been completed and cooled, they can be removed and cut to the desired length. The uPVC window frame is then fitted with fittings. It is crucial to install uPVC windows with extreme sensitivity if they are glass pane windows.

Other components of windows can be made, in addition to the frames. This includes door and window hinges, cylinders, and fittings. These components play a significant impact on the price and quality of the product.

Window frames are then joined together with the help of heat-based welding. To give the profiles more strength, it is possible to add galvanized steel or aluminum reinforcements.

To ensure that the final product is of the highest quality, the raw materials are selected carefully. Then, they are blended into a specific ratio of chemicals. This gives the window white index, UV resistance and other properties.
